Current Landscape: Where AI Skills Stand Today

As of 2025, AI skills are already causing tectonic shifts, with 15% of freelance job postings requiring basic AI literacy--a figure that has doubled since 2022. Routine tasks in writing, data analysis, and customer service are being automated at scale, yet gaps persist in advanced competencies like AI system integration or bias mitigation. Workings.me's analysis of gig economy data reveals that workers with AI-augmented skills earn 20% more on average, highlighting the urgency for upskilling.

Skill Category Current Automation Risk Projected Growth by 2026
Basic Content Creation High (40%) -10%
Data Entry & Processing Very High (60%) -15%
AI Prompt Engineering Low (5%) +70%
Ethical AI Oversight Low (10%) +50%

External data from the World Economic Forum corroborates this, noting that 44% of workers' skills will be disrupted in the next five years. Key Signals Pointing to Accelerated Disruption

Five critical signals underscore the rapid pace of AI skills disruption: (1) Venture capital funding for AI startups surged to $50 billion in 2024, accelerating tool deployment; (2) Corporate adoption of AI agents for tasks like contract review has grown 300% year-over-year, displacing human roles; (3) Educational platforms report a 150% increase in enrollments for AI-related courses, indicating skill panic; (4) Government regulations, such as the EU AI Act, are creating demand for compliance experts; and (5) Productivity gains from AI--up to 40% in some sectors--are pushing firms to reallocate human labor to higher-value work.

What is AI skills disruption and why does it matter for independent workers?

AI skills disruption refers to the rapid automation of routine tasks and the emergence of new skill demands driven by artificial intelligence, fundamentally reshaping job markets. For independent workers, this means existing competencies may become obsolete, while hybrid skills--combining technical AI literacy with human-centric abilities--will be critical for sustaining income. Which skills are most at risk from AI automation in the near term?

In the near term, skills involving repetitive data entry, basic content generation, and routine administrative tasks are at highest risk, as AI tools like language models and automation software become more accessible. For example, roles in customer service, entry-level writing, and simple coding may see significant displacement by 2026.
